Transaction 7bbfe251207c95967315fadb526fd82508800d566c40efae9c77ab82e90ea3de
1 Input
1 Output
-
7bbfe251207c95967315fadb526fd82508800d566c40efae9c77ab82e90ea3de:0
- value
- 186259
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e6c18a5166209bfef0abe1d8cef2f7f7a50ee5115ac4365da3096b3d54ec18d3
- address
- tb1pumqc55txyzdlau9tu8vvauhh77jsaeg3ttzrvhdrp94n648vrrfs7wql9r